> Hello All,
> Dear Luis,
>
> In gnuhealth, we provide the price for individual service or goods
> registered at the time of registration, and while generating an
> invoice, a user has to key-in the price of goods or services
> selected.

They should automatically show up in the invoice if the invoice is
generated from the related service document.

>
> Please, how possible it will be, once generating an invoice it will
> automatically replicate the amount initially assigned for the service
> or goods.

So that would go in the opposite flow... because ideally, the patient
has  a list of services assigned in the service document lines, then,
depending on the pricelist / insurance, there will be an invoice price.

I might not be understanding you correctly, so please let me know if
this is ok or what is the goal :)
